Bulgaria - National Annual Road Freight Transport of All Types of Goods Loaded in Intermediate Regions
Since 2014, Bulgaria National Annual Road Freight Transport of All Types of Goods Loaded in Intermediate Regions was down by 2.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 14 comparing other countries in National Annual Road Freight Transport of All Types of Goods Loaded in Intermediate Regions with 88,368 Thousand Metric Tons. Bulgaria is overtaken by Belgium, which was number 13 at 101,914 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Denmark with 87,170 Thousand Metric Tons. Germany lead the ranking with 1,368,680 Thousand Metric Tons in 2018, that is an increase of 2% versus 2017. Spain, Italy and Poland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Cyprus witnessed the best average annual growth at +13.3% per year, while Greece was the worst growing country at -7.2% per year.
